    Gut problems? Get it checked out guys

    Just wanted to put this out there. Guys who are experiencing gut problems from pfs (most of us I think) need to follow up on that. I got an endoscopy and colonoscopy done today because of my pfs related gut issues and weight loss. They removed quite a few polyps in my bowel which is not normal for someone my age. These can become cancerous if not found early so it's a good thing they did.

    Not 100% that this started from pfs, but I wouldn't doubt it.
